Painting Description
"Estudo de nu" is a painting by the Brazilian artist José Ferraz de Almeida Júnior, a prominent figure in 19th-century Brazilian art. Almeida Júnior is known for his contributions to the development of a national identity in Brazilian painting, often incorporating local themes and subjects into his work. Born in 1850 in Itu, São Paulo, he studied at the Imperial Academy of Fine Arts in Rio de Janeiro and later in Paris, where he was influenced by European academic traditions.
The painting "Estudo de nu" exemplifies Almeida Júnior's skill in rendering the human form, showcasing his academic training and mastery of anatomy. The work is a study of the nude, a common subject in academic art, allowing artists to explore the complexities of the human body and the play of light and shadow on skin. This piece reflects the influence of European realism, which Almeida Júnior encountered during his studies abroad, yet it also embodies a distinct Brazilian sensibility.
Almeida Júnior's approach to the nude was both technical and expressive, capturing not only the physicality of the subject but also a sense of presence and emotion. His use of light and shadow demonstrates a keen understanding of chiaroscuro, adding depth and volume to the figure. The painting is likely to have been created as part of his academic exercises, which were essential for artists of his time to refine their skills and techniques.
"Estudo de nu" is part of Almeida Júnior's broader oeuvre, which includes portraits, genre scenes, and landscapes, all contributing to his reputation as a key figure in Brazilian art history. His works are celebrated for their technical proficiency and their role in shaping a Brazilian artistic identity during a period of cultural and political transformation in the country.
